## Executive Snapshot
**What it is:** The Division Resurgence is a tactical open-world RPG for mobile, featuring co-op combat and PvPvE zones set in a persistent New York City.
**Why users hire it:** Players hire the game for a high-fidelity, canon-driven tactical shooter experience that mirrors console-level immersion on mobile devices.

### The Division Resurgence vs Arena Breakout: Realistic FPS
- **[Arena Breakout: Realistic FPS](https://marlvel.ai/apps/arena-breakout-realistic-fps)** by Level Infinite: This title dominates the tactical extraction shooter niche on mobile, directly competing for the same hardcore audience seeking realistic military simulation.
  - **Key differences:**
    - Features a high-stakes extraction loop that forces players to risk gear, unlike standard respawn-based shooters.
    - Implements complex weapon modification systems that allow for granular, realistic customization of every firearm component.
    - Utilizes a realistic health system where specific body parts require distinct medical treatments to restore functionality.

### Contenders (Strong Challengers)
- **[Call of Duty®: Mobile](https://marlvel.ai/apps/call-of-duty-mobile)** by Activision Publishing, Inc.: The massive scale and feature-rich nature of this title make it the primary benchmark for all mobile shooters.
  - Offers a massive variety of game modes including Battle Royale, classic multiplayer, and seasonal limited-time events.
  - Maintains a highly polished, fast-paced arcade shooting feel that is significantly more accessible than tactical simulators.
- **[PUBG MOBILE](https://marlvel.ai/apps/pubg-mobile)** by Tencent Mobile International Limited: As the pioneer of mobile battle royale, it commands a massive, entrenched player base that this app must compete against for daily active time.
  - Features a mature, battle-tested battle royale ecosystem with deep social integration and established competitive esports circuits.
  - Provides a highly optimized, large-scale map experience that supports massive player counts in a single session.
- **[Blood Strike - FPS for all](https://marlvel.ai/apps/com-netease-newspike)** by NetEase Games: A high-velocity, movement-focused shooter that captures the younger, fast-paced demographic with frequent content updates.
  - Prioritizes ultra-fast movement mechanics and parkour-style traversal that contrast with this app's grounded tactical pacing.
  - Maintains an aggressive release cadence with ten major updates in six months to keep the meta fresh.

### Peers (What They Do Better)
- **[Modern Combat 5: mobile FPS](https://marlvel.ai/apps/modern-combat-5-mobile-fps)** by Gameloft SE: A legacy mobile shooter that serves as a baseline for traditional campaign and multiplayer FPS experiences.
  - Focuses on a traditional, linear campaign structure that offers a more guided experience than open-world titles.
  - Provides a classic class-based multiplayer system that is simpler to balance than modern open-world RPG shooters.
- **[Lost Light: Weapon Skin Treat](https://marlvel.ai/apps/lost-light-weapon-skin-treat)** by NETEASE INTERACTIVE ENTERTAINMENT PTE. LTD: An extraction-based shooter that focuses heavily on the economy and social trading aspects of the genre.
  - Integrates a player-driven marketplace for trading loot, which creates a distinct economic layer missing in this app.
  - Emphasizes social cooperation and shelter management as core pillars of the progression loop.
